Two closed containers of equal volume of air are initially at 1.05×105 Pa and 300 K temperature. If the containers are connected by a narrow tube and one container is maintained at 300 K temperature and other at 400 K temperature. The final pressure (in kPa) in the containers is ______________kPa.

Final pressure in both the containers remain same as they are connected. If initial pressure volume and temperatures of the two containers are denoted by P0V0 and T0 and Pf,V0T2 and PfV0T2, are the final pressure volume and temperature in the two containers then according to gas law and constant number of moles, we have P02V0T0=PfV0T1+PfV0T2or Pf=2P0T0×T1T2T1+T2Here it is given that P0=105KPa,T0=300K,T1=300K, T2=400K, then we get Pf=2×105×103×400300+400=120kPa
